Skeletons in the Closet, digital painting by Rachel Glen

A note from the artist: 


Recently I’ve seen a lot of discourse around whether or not men should be allowed to wear dresses and skirts and decided to make this piece. The expectations put on us as a society to dress a certain way is very crushing for many, the idea that what someone wears dictates their femininity or masculinity doesn’t make sense. Clothing is just a bunch of fibers woven together and sewn to be a certain shape. Our bones look the same regardless of gender. Throughout history, all over the world, men have worn dresses. I wanted to create a drawing that if you look at it for longer maybe you realize that just from this picture you can’t tell the gender of the subject based on what it’s wearing.
